Recent changes

APPROVAL_CHANGE

Project Perception documents human sign-off for every high-impact action, with defender-set objectives and guardrails.

AUTHORIZATIONOPERATIONSRISK

ARCHITECTURE_CHANGE

Project Perception documents a red/blue/green multi-agent architecture coordinated by orchestrated workflows and an orchestration harness.

ARCHITECTUREEVALUATIONRISK

AUTONOMY_FACET_CHANGE

Project Perception assigns work execution to agents while reserving judgment to humans.

AUTHORIZATIONEVALUATIONRISK

AVAILABILITY_LIFECYCLE_CHANGE

Project Perception is in preview, initially delivered through Microsoft Defender, with broader Microsoft Security expansion planned.

DEPLOYMENTEVALUATIONPROCUREMENT

AVAILABILITY_LIFECYCLE_CHANGE

Microsoft Learn identifies Project Perception as Limited Public Preview.

DEPLOYMENTPROCUREMENT

ARCHITECTURE_CHANGE

Project Perception combines signals, context, models, and red/blue/green agents through coordinated playbooks.

ARCHITECTUREEVALUATIONRISK

AUTONOMY_FACET_CHANGE

Project Perception supports autonomous execution initiated through reusable playbooks.

AUTHORIZATIONOPERATIONSRISK

CONTROL_CHANGE

Operators can approve or reject requested agent actions, stop sessions, and provide alternative guidance.

AUTHORIZATIONOPERATIONSRISK
